video: Benches Clear, Scuffle Ensues Between Red Sox and Rays
Monday, May 26, 2014
Rays' shortstop Yunel Escobar stole third base with 2 outs in the bottom of the 7th inning. With Tampa Bay nursing a 5-run lead, the Red Sox dugout (located on the 3rd base side) threw a hissy fit, as Escobar had violated one of baseball's unwritten rules about not adding insult to injury for the irritable Red Sox.
Escobar angrily chirped back at the dugout, and at that point Jonny Gomes had arrived from left field to initiate what erupted into a bench clearing skirmish between the division rivals. When the dust finally settled, Escobar, Gomes, and the Rays' Sean Rodriguez were all ejected.
